Output f583427cc6050489075ea721a5546f377dec9cc126dc180dcad2c463832b5ca7:18

value
99250495
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57bf5bcf198979f092e8681bff1a80e4b972b156 OP_EQUALVERIFY OP_CHECKSIG
address
18zy2X9qsZq7NTwDR6JHazxceMhwaGBvHv
transaction
f583427cc6050489075ea721a5546f377dec9cc126dc180dcad2c463832b5ca7
spent
true